3. Components of Solid Control Equipment

Industry Efficiency Solutions – Solid control equipment typically consists of several components working together harmoniously. These include shale shakers, centrifuges, desanders, desilters, and mud cleaners. Each component plays a unique role in the solid control process, ensuring that drilling fluids remain free of unwanted solids.

4. How Does Solid Control Equipment Work?

Think of solid control equipment as a series of filters and separators. When drilling fluid containing solids is pumped to the surface, it passes through various stages of filtration and separation. Shale shakers remove large solids, while centrifuges and hydrocyclones separate finer particles. The result? Clean drilling fluid ready to be reused in the drilling process.

  2. What are the common maintenance challenges associated with solid control equipment?
    Common maintenance challenges include equipment wear and tear, clogging of filters, and corrosion due to exposure to harsh chemicals.
